TE 264 - Teaching Methods in the Secondary School


An overview of applications of learning theory and teaching methodology for the humanities and arts, the social sciences, and the natural sciences and mathematics at the secondary level. The underlying structure of each subject area is examined, and models for teaching are developed and used. Micro-teaching and unit preparation are integral parts of this course. This lab course meets three times a week for two credits. First semester.

Credits: 2
